Some ideas planned for Amazon’s Fallout adaptation had to be nixed, because Bethesda has them earmarked for Fallout 5.
In an interview with Den of Geek, Bethesda’s Todd Howard – who is serving as an executive producer on the Amazon series – said on occasion he had to tell the show’s team: “Don’t do this because we are going to do that in Fallout 5.”
While it’s a shame we don’t know exactly what those ideas were, it’s proof of how authentic this adaptation is shaping up to be.
Howard’s comment comes after showrunner Jonathan Nolan suggested the upcoming series was almost like Fallout 5. “I don’t want to sound presumptuous, but it’s just a non-interactive version of it, right,” he remarked earlier this month. Nolan, who was also present during Den of Geek’s interview, clarified his earlier comments, stating it would be “very presumptuous for someone to assume that we’d reach the calibre of the games”, while fellow showrunner Graham Wagner quipped: “I think we made Fallout 6.”
